Transaction 344601014c71684ca595b77e0b2c61f4e68e9f43ec3e7138ca3f05e5a74dcfff

1 Input
2 Outputs
  • 344601014c71684ca595b77e0b2c61f4e68e9f43ec3e7138ca3f05e5a74dcfff:0
  • value  2792000
    address  1DacKh7GwauqYanZKyc1nvNFbuGf6P8Fhh
  • 344601014c71684ca595b77e0b2c61f4e68e9f43ec3e7138ca3f05e5a74dcfff:1
  • value  29352880
    address  1HHheyhYbiaqkREN3hpRD9NS1236U1mbgd